The 1812 Marine Guard for USS Constitution

Historic Marine Education, Inc. is an all-volunteer, educational, 501-c corporation headquartered at the oldest Marine barracks in the United States, located in the Charlestown Navy Yard – Boston, Massachusetts.

Our primary mission is to educate the public about all aspects of early 19th century life with a particular focus on maritime heritage and the U.S. Marines.

The unit partners with the U.S. Navy and National Park Service to present year-round educational programs for the public. The entire unit musters for “Underway Sailing Demonstrations” on board USS Constitution under the direction of the United States Navy. The Marine Guard is tasked to provide musketry training for sailors aboard USS Constitution and provides honors and ceremonies for the ship. The Guard also give lectures and makes appearances upon request.
